The Plan Benefit Analyst builds medical, dental, vision, and other employee benefit plans of clients into claims processing system.
Candidate is responsible for building and maintaining the logic in the claim system that drives accurate and appropriate claims adjudication.
Essential Functions:
System configuration of medical, dental, vision, and other benefit plans into claim system to accurately adjudicate benefits.
Includes initial build and subsequent modifications.
Configuration is limited to utilization of logic-based modules embedded in claim system; does not include actual coding.
Verification of configuration output and collaboration with internal divisions for completion of review and testing.
Receives, researches and responds to technical inquiries related to system configuration.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
